Myne, a UAE-based wealth and asset tracking platform, has raised $2 million to redefine how individuals and businesses track and manage their finances and to scale its operations, deepen Myne’s technology infrastructure, accelerate user acquisition, support its innovation pipeline, and create a roadmap for regional expansion.

The pre-seed funding round was led by Scene Holding, followed by Raz Holding with participation from Plus VC, the most active VC in the MENA, Annex Investments, and a group of strategic angel investors.

Launched in 2024, Myne was inspired by Karim’s frustration of managing scattered financial details and assets across different platforms. Karim’s background in tech helped solve the problem and a platform was designed to simplify wealth management by bringing all assets together in real-time while ensuring they are organised, accessible, and protected.

Myne aims to establish a strong foothold in the UAE before launching in Saudi Arabia and the other GCC markets. The firm will also use its funds to solidify its position as a leading innovator in the fintech space in the region.

Myne offers a user-friendly platform with comprehensive financial management tools for individuals, professionals, and businesses. By addressing gaps in wealth tracking, budgeting, spending, and estate planning, Myne empowers users to make smarter financial decisions and secure their futures. With the ability to sync unlimited banking assets—banks, stocks, crypto brokers, exchanges, and wallets—Myne supports over 10 currencies. Users can access a personal wealth dashboard with real-time price updates, intuitive budgeting tools, and connect with top-tier wealth planners, providing a complete solution for financial well-being.
